改變原來的陣列:
var a = 「hello,」;
var b = 「my lover~」
var c = a.concat(b);
//輸出結果:hello,my lover~
var a = [「hello」, 「litter」, 「boy」];
var b = a.join();
//輸出結果:hello,litter,boy
var a = [1, 2, 3, 4, 5, 6];
var b = a.slice(0, 3);
//輸出結果:[1, 2, 3]
var a = [1, 2, 3];
var b = a.pop();
//輸出結果:3
var a = [1, 3, 5];
var b = a.reverse();
//輸出結果:b = [5, 3, 1]
var a = [1, 3, 5];
var b = a.shift();
//輸出結果:b = 1
var a = 「how are you doing today?」;
var b = str.split(" ");
//輸出結果: [「how」, 「are」, 「you」, 「doing」, 「today?」]
var a=[『a』,『b』,『c』];
var b=a.splice(1,1,『d』,『e』);
//輸出結果:b=[『b』] 替換a的值,返回被刪除的值
(a=[『a』,『d』,『e』,『c』])
function msg(name,job,born)
var setmsg = new msg(「小斌語錄」,「coder」,1997);
console.log(setmsg .tosource())
//輸出結果:()
var a = new boolean(true);
console.log(a.tostring());
//輸出結果:true
var a=[1,2,3,4,5];
var b=a.unshift(0);
//輸出結果:b = 6
(a=[0,1,2,3,4,5])
var a = new boolean(true);
console.log(a.valueof());
//輸出結果:true
Array物件常用方法
shift 刪除原陣列的第一項,返回刪除元素的值 如果陣列為空則返回undefined var arr 1,2,3,4,5 varout arr.shift console.log arr 2,3,4,5 console.log out 1 var arr varout arr.shift cons...
Array 物件常用的方法總結
shift 刪除原陣列的第一項,返回刪除元素的值 如果陣列為空則返回undefined var arr 1,2,3,4,5 var out arr.shift console.log arr 2,3,4,5 console.log out 1 var arr var out arr.shift co...
JS常用陣列Array方法詳解
push 在陣列末尾新增乙個或多個元素,並返回新的陣列長度,原陣列改變 pop 刪除並返回陣列最後乙個元素,若陣列為空則返回undefined,原陣列改變 unshift 在陣列開頭新增乙個或多個元素並返回新的陣列長度,原陣列改變 shift 刪除並返回陣列第乙個元素,若陣列為空則返回undefin...